What is a remote MFT associate?

Remote MFT Associates are early-career Marriage and Family Therapists who provide therapy services to individuals, couples, and families via telehealth platforms. They typically work under the supervision of a licensed therapist as they gain the clinical hours required for full licensure. This remote role allows them to meet clients virtually, offering flexibility for both therapists and clients, and expanding access to mental health care. Remote MFT Associates may work for private practices, teletherapy companies, or community mental health organizations.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a remote MFT associate?

To thrive as a Remote MFT Associate, you need a master’s degree in marriage and family therapy or a related field, completion of required clinical hours, and state associate licensure. Familiarity with telehealth platforms, secure communication tools, and electronic health record (EHR) systems is essential. Exceptional listening, empathy, cultural competency, and strong communication skills help build rapport and trust with clients remotely. These abilities are vital for delivering effective therapy, maintaining ethical standards, and supporting clients’ mental health in a virtual environment.

How do remote MFT associates typically collaborate with supervisors and peers while working off-site?

Remote MFT Associates often engage in regular virtual supervision sessions, which may occur via video calls or secure online platforms, to discuss cases and receive guidance. Collaboration with peers often happens through scheduled team meetings, online forums, or group supervision, fostering a sense of community and shared learning even at a distance. Effective communication and comfort with digital tools are important, as much of the collaboration relies on technology. Many organizations provide structured opportunities for remote associates to connect, ensuring ongoing professional development and support.

What is the difference between Remote Mft Associate vs Remote LPC Associate?

AspectRemote Mft AssociateRemote LPC Associate
Required CredentialsMaster's in Marriage and Family Therapy, MFT license eligibilityMaster's in Counseling or Psychology, LPC license eligibility
Work EnvironmentTelehealth, private practices, clinicsTelehealth, mental health clinics, private practices
Industry UsagePrimarily in mental health and therapy servicesPrimarily in mental health counseling and therapy

Both Remote Mft Associates and Remote LPC Associates typically require a master's degree and are involved in providing mental health services via telehealth. The main difference lies in their licensure and specialization: MFT Associates focus on marriage and family therapy, while LPC Associates specialize in general mental health counseling. Both roles are common in telehealth settings and serve similar client needs, making them closely related career paths.
